Cesar Azpilicueta set to complete Inter Milan switch as Chelsea allow legend to leave club early

Cesar Azpilicueta is set to complete a move to Inter Milan this summer.

The defender has agreed a two-year deal with the Italian giants with terms fully agreed over the move.

As part of the arrangement, Chelsea will terminate his contract at Stamford Bridge, allowing the club legend to leave for new a challenge.

As a result he'll join the Champions League finalists as he pursues a new challenge as he moves into the latter years of his career.

The Spanish defender completed a move to west London 11 years ago after joining from Marseille back in 2012.

Since then, the 33-year-old has gone onto make 508 appearances for the Blues, scoring 17 goals in the process.

He also has a pretty spectacular trophy haul to his name, having won two Premier League titles, a Champions League, two Europa Leagues, a UEFA Super Cup and a FIFA Club World Cup.

Azpilcueta won't be the last player to leave Chelsea this summer either, with stars such as Kalidou Koulibaly, Hakim Ziyech and Mason Mount among the frontrunners to move on.

However few players will be as big a miss at Stamford Bridge as the popular defender.
